If I need to cancel my hotel reservation in Pauwalu, will I receive a refund?
Yes! Most hotel reservations are fully refundable if you cancel prior to the hotel's cancellation deadline, which is usually within 24-48 hours of your arrival date. If you have a non-refundable reservation, you may still be able to cancel and receive a refund within a 24-hour period of booking. What's the seasonal weather like in Pauwalu?
The hottest months are usually September and August,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are February and March, with an average of 23°C. Average annual precipitation for Pauwalu is 224 mm.
